NCP605, NCP606
PIN FUNCTION DESCRIPTION
Pin No.
Pin Name
Description
1
Vin
Positive Power Supply Input*
2
GND
Power Supply Ground
3
NC/EN
NCP605: This Pin is Not Connected
NCP606: This Pin is Enable Input, Active HIGH
4
Vout
Regulated Output Voltage
5
SENSE/ADJ Output Voltage Sense Input
Fixed Version: Connect Directly to Output Capacitor
Adjustable Version: Connect to Middle Point of External Resistor Divider
6
Vin
Positive Power Supply Input*
EPAD
GND
Exposed Pad is Connected to Ground
*Pins 1 and 6 must be connected together externally for output current full range operation

Stresses exceeding Maximum Ratings may damage the device. Maximum Ratings are stress ratings only. Functional operation above the
Recommended Operating Conditions is not implied. Extended exposure to stresses above the Recommended Operating Conditions may affect
device reliability.
NOTE: This device series contains ESD Protection and exceeds the following tests:
ESD Human Body Model tested per AECQ100002 (EIA/JESD22A114)
ESD Machine Model tested per AEC150 mA per JEDEC standard: JESD78Q100003 (EIA/JESD22A115)
Latchup Current Maximum Rating: v 150 mA per JEDEC standard: JESD78.
1. Minimum Vin = (Vout + VDO) or 1.5 V, whichever is higher.
